Transaction 91c3118ef9283d7d878dfc56ed2a66efe7199e6990dfa0af8e927341b790eea0
1 Input
1 Output
-
91c3118ef9283d7d878dfc56ed2a66efe7199e6990dfa0af8e927341b790eea0:0
- value
- 20024292
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f89ad6fda62ad7f83319aaa9953e3055fea0468b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PfW52t1PMe2Hsj6JfA9PXXaC2QZkJf8fa